What is Menopause?
Menopause can be defined as the period of time after a patient stops menstruating for 12 consecutive months. The time leading up to it is known as perimenopause, where patients experience changes such as irregular periods, hot flashes, changes to their mood, and more.
While aging leads to menopause due to a gradual decrease in hormones—estrogen and progesterone—produced by the ovaries, earlier menopause can often occur in patients that have surgery to remove their ovaries, cancer, or other illnesses.
What Are the Symptoms of Menopause?
While some patients may experience no symptoms of menopause, for others, the following are common:
- change in menstrual cycle, often irregular periods
- loss of hair
- vaginal dryness
- changes to mood, increase in irritability
- difficulty concentrating
- changes to skin
- urinary incontinence
- night sweats and hot flashes
- osteoporosis
- atherosclerosis
